Get PriceHydrothermal Synthesis of Magnesium Aluminate Platelets
Nov 10 2006 · Magnesium aluminate (MgAl 2 O 4) platelets were first synthesized by hydrothermal treatment of γ‐AlO(OH) in a magnesium nitrate aqueous solution at 400°C.The platelets are 100–200 nm in width and 25 nm in thickness. The influence of temperature the anions of the magnesium salt the amount of magnesium salt and precursor pH on the formation of such structure was investigated.

Get PriceSynthesis and Densification of Transparent Magnesium
Mixtures of elementary oxides MgO–Al 2 O 3 were used to fabricate transparent polycrystalline magnesium aluminate spinel specimens by means of the spark plasma sintering technique.A sintering aid 1 wt of LiF was added to the mixed powder. The presence of the additive promotes the synthesis of spinel that starts at 900°C and is completed at 1100°C.

Get PriceSynthesis characterization and formation mechanism of
Jan 31 2015 · The synthesis of Friedel s salt (FS 3CaO·A12O3·CaCl2·10H2O) by the reaction of calcium chloride with sodium aluminate was investigated. Factors affecting the preparation of Friedel s salt such as reaction temperature initial concentration titration speed aging time and molar Ca/Al ratio were studied in detail.
